Biography
Sharon Thomas Cain is an American actress born on June 3, 1946, in New York, United States. She is known for her roles in films such as “Young Guns” (1988), “Star Trek III: The Search for Spock” (1984), and “The Principal” (1987). She has been married to Christopher Cain since 1969, and together they have three children: musician Roger Cain, actor Dean Cain, and actress Krisinda Cain Schafer. Prior to her marriage to Christopher Cain, she was married to Roger Tanaka from 1964 to 1966, during which time they had two sons, Roger and Dean. Christopher Cain adopted the boys and gave them his surname. Sharon Thomas Cain has also worked in the script and continuity department.
